Srinagar, Aug 30 (IANS) Nine guerrillas have so far been killed in an ongoing gunfight between a band of infiltrators and army troops in north Kashmir’s Uri sector, defence sources said Monday.

‘So far, nine terrorists have been killed in the gunfight that erupted when a heavily armed group of infiltrating terrorists was challenged in Uri sector of the LOC (Line of Control) by the alert troops of the army yesterday (Sunday). The gunfight is still on,’ the sources said late Monday evening.

Twelve AK-47 rifles, five GPS sets, two satellite phones, eight radio sets, one cell phone and Rs.1 lakh in Indian currency have been recovered from the slain terrorists, they said, adding the identity of the slain terrorists was being established.
